A gold mine of advice and guidance from an international team of entrepreneurial all-stars
From TiE, the world's largest not-for-profit entrepreneurial organization, this valuable handbook features chapters written by acknowledged experts in their respective fields. It covers all areas of vital concern to entrepreneurs-as well as the accountants, venture capitalists, and attorneys who work with them-including legal issues, venture funding, management teams, stock options, business planning, and much more.
TiE is a worldwide organization founded in Silicon Valley over a decade ago and dedicated to promoting entrepreneurial ventures. Its members number 800 professionals in forty-one locations in eight countries.

Text addresses many of the common questions and issues faced by new and seasoned entrepreneurs. Includes an overview of entrepreneurship, discusses the attributes of a region or nation that fosters the spirit of risk taking and economic value creation, and the characteristics of successful entrepreneurs.
